Sergio Aguero To Miss Juventus Clash

Manchester City will be without the services of Sergio Aguero when they take on Juventus in their first Champions League match.
The Argentine striker missed training after leaving last weekend’s match against Crystal Palace due to injury.

City would however be delighted that Raheem Sterling and David Silva, who missed the Palace game, trained with the squad.
Manager Manuel Pellegrini speaking at today’s press conference said; “Sergio is not fit for tomorrow, He has an injury in his knee.
“We will see this afternoon how long it will be, but I hope he can be back for the weekend.”
“David Silva and Raheem Sterling are fit.”
Regardless of who is available or not, The Citizens would be eager to prove their mettle in Europe this season, and will be definitely be going for the win.

“Last year we had a difficult group but we did well in the last two games and we qualify and after that we play against Barcelona again. We played against the strongest team two years in a row.”
“It is very important to not only have a successful team here but in Europe. I hope we will not play against Barcelona in the round of 16.”
